Sisters and Husbands is a rewrite of the original story first released in 2002. In the blurb Brookfield says she was hesitant to do this, but upon re-reading the story was surprised to discover that over the years, not a lot in regard to families, has changed.

Anna and Becky are sisters who are very close to each other. Their pathways in life have been diametrically opposite. Anna is the peacemaker, the planner and the one driven to succeed.

Becky is the impulsive one, making spur of the moment decisions that have long lasting consequences. She and her mother have a very difficult relationship, stemming from the death of their father in France some years earlier.

When Anna’s carefully laid plans go wrong and Becky’s life falls apart, they are there for each other but can they find their way through the challenges of Anna’s situation, that of becoming a mother and Becky’s, that of having to rebuild her life as a single woman.

There are several strands to this story which do add to the interest; Anna’s husband is not coping with his wife being pregnant, Becky’s husband has gone ahead and established his own restaurant.

But where will the trail of lies, deception and love lead as family secrets are uncovered and everyone has to accept that while the past can and does influence the present, it is just that, the past!

Slow to begin the story does pick up pace a little further in and makes an entertaining read.
